WebDeborah Brandt is Professor of English at the University of Wisconsin–Madison. She is author of Literacy as Involvement, which won the 1993 David H. Russell Award for Distinguished Research from the National Council of Teachers of English. In 1998–1999,she was a Visiting Fellow at the U.S. Department of Education in Washington,D.C. Page 4 … Web23 sep. 2024 · By analyzing the literacy histories of hundreds of Americans from all walks of life, Brandt documents the effects that the changing economic, political, and sociocultural conditions in American society have had on literacy acquisition and usage, from the 1900s to the present day.
